Maine
Currently Maine does not have any laws regulating payday loan stores, however there are laws on cash dispensing machines that offer cash advances. As for machines that dispense cash advances in Maine, no fee shall be imposed on a cash advance loan unless the fee is clearly disclosed electronically during the transaction.
All cash advance machines in Maine must follow certain guidelines. They must all provide a receipt of the transaction. On the receipt there must be certain items listed including the amount of the transaction, the amount of any fees, the total amount debited to the customer’s account the date and time of the transaction, a number code that identifies the customer and the account, and a location of the cash dispensing machine.
On each machine, the name of the operator must be included as well as a disclaimer saying the operator is not a financial institution. The machine must also have a notice that states a name, address, and 24-hour toll free telephone number where a customer can call in to complain. A cash advance-dispensing machine must also have a notice stating they reserve the right to charge a service fee. These Maine laws were recently put in effect on January 31st, 2000.
